UAH MIPS X-Band Profiling Radar (XPR) Data
Summary
This data set contains radial wind and reflectivity profiles from the University of Alabama-Huntsville (UAH) vertically-pointing X-Band Profiling Radar (XPR) during the 2016 VORTEX-SE field season. The XPR is part of the UAH Mobile Integrated Profiling System (MIPS) system. The data are in both raw scan files and processed universal format files. Quicklook imagery are also included.
